Debra Dalgleish - 29 Dec 2004 17:15 GMT
If you have Excel 2002, or later version, right-click on the sheet tab
Choose Tab Color, and select a colour.

Debra Dalgleish - 30 Dec 2004 12:41 GMT
No, you can't change the tab colour in Excel 2000. The feature was
introduced in Excel 2002.
